Morse code is a telecommunications method which encodes text characters as standardized sequences of two different signal durations, called dots and dashes, or dits and dahs.

    Eve Online (stylised EVE Online) is a space-based, persistent world massively multiplayer online role-playing game (MMORPG) developed and published by CCP Games.Players of Eve Online can participate in a number of in-game professions and activities, including mining, piracy, manufacturing, trading, exploration, and combat (both player versus environment (PVE) and player versus player (PVP)).

    Freelancer is a space trading and combat simulation video game developed by Digital Anvil and published by Microsoft Game Studios.It is a chronological sequel to Digital Anvil's Starlancer, a combat flight simulator released in 2000.
